accuracy problems with new barrel
284 winchester, 1-9.5 kreiger tube, 162 gr bullet, .010 from touching.
shot three rounds in 1.5" group, went in loaded 3 more, shot them. the second 3 cut the first 3.if it was bedding i do not think they would exactly cut the first 3.
58gr 4831 sc
interarms mauser action, brll carlson stock with aluminum bedding insert.

Re: accuracy problems with new barrel
Have you tried any other powder charge weights or powders altogether? Sounds like you may need to do a ladder test to find your barrel's sweet spot.

Re: accuracy problems with new barrel
as long as your rifle and bedding and scope setup are sound
If you haven't done a seating depth trial
that's the first thing I'd do
seating depth can greatly affect grouping and is often the
cure for double grouping
